Caprese and Garlic-Butter Bread





Serves 12 |
A yummy appetizer for a classic Italian meal.
Ingredients:
3 tomatoes, sliced |
3 cloves garlic, finely minced |
Salt, to taste |
1 loaf Italian bread |
1/2 cup Balsamic vinegar |
Ground black pepper, to taste |
4 tablespoons butter |
1/3 cup basil leaves, fresh, chopped |
12 oz Mozzarella cheese, sliced |
Directions:
- Pour balsamic vinegar into a saucepan. Bring pan to a boil. Once boiling, reduce heat and let simmer for 5 minutes.
- Preheat oven to 400° F.
- Combine butter and garlic in a small bowl.
- Cut loaf in half and butter well. Place bread on a baking sheet. Sprinkle with Mozzarella cheese.
- Bake for 12 minutes. Cheese should be melted and the edges of the bread are browned.
- Remove from oven, top bread with basil and tomatoes, season with pepper and salt. Drizzle balsamic vinegar over the top.
- Slice into serving sizes and enjoy.
